The Marketing Academy UK 2026 Scholarship is a free development program for the best emerging leaders in the Marketing, Advertising, Communication and Media industries in the UK. It’s a highly selective program with a rigourous selection process that starts with a nomination.

Here’s how it works:
To be eligible to apply, all potential Scholars must first be ‘nominated’ by someone who believes them to be the best and the brightest marketing talent in the UK. Every ‘nominee’ will then receive an ‘Invitation to Apply’ for the Scholarship by email. They must ensure they can attend all boot camp sessions.
Once the nominee receives the ‘Invitation to Apply’ they must submit a 3-part application: a CV, an endorsement from their employer and a two minute ‘Showcase Me’. Those that get through this initial screening will then embark on a rigorous selection process.
Here’s the selection criteria:
- Ideally between 8 and 18 years in a marketing or agency role
- Currently in a leadership role
- Highly ambitious to further career in marketing leadership, aspiring to C-Suite or board roles
- Demonstrates commitment to career with evidence of results and achievements
- Evidence of commitment to broadening horizons, such as an interest in charitable, social, cultural, creative, travel or sporting endeavours
- High emotional intelligence & natural drive to succeed
- Currently employed on a permanent basis* in the UK and have worked in current company for a minimum of 6 months.
- No known risk of termination or resignation for the duration of the program
*Please note: We have Scholarships available for individuals who do not have a ‘classic’ marketing background. Those who have demonstrated exceptional potential as natural marketers or who have shown outstanding entrepreneurial ability or exceptional achievement in the face of adversity will be considered.
*There are many reasons that this program is not suited to individuals currently in transition between roles or freelancing. Please refer to the FAQ section on pages 8-10 of the Program Guide for more information and support.
